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-Gln(Trt)-Gly-OH
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-Gln(Trt)-Gly-OH is a protected tetrapeptide utilized in peptide synthesis. The Boc (tert-Butoxycarbonyl) group safeguards the N-terminus of the D-tyrosine (D-Tyr) residue, while the OtBu (tert-butyl) group protects the hydroxyl group on the D-tyrosine's side chain, preventing premature reactions during synthesis. The second residue, Aib (α-aminoisobutyric acid), is known for its ability to induce helical conformations in peptides. The Gln (Glutamine) residue has its side chain protected by a Trt (Trityl) group, allowing for selective deprotection later in the synthesis process. The final residue, Gly (Glycine), has a free carboxyl group at the C-terminus, denoted by -OH, which can be used for further coupling or modifications. This peptide is specifically designed to incorporate D-tyrosine, Aib, glutamine, and glycine into peptide structures, with carefully selected protective groups to ensure controlled and efficient synthesis.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-Glu(OtBu)-Gly-OH
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-Glu(OtBu)-Gly-OH is a protected tetrapeptide used in peptide synthesis. The Boc (tert-Butoxycarbonyl) group protects the N-terminus of the D-tyrosine (D-Tyr) residue, preventing it from reacting during synthesis. The side chain hydroxyl group of D-tyrosine and the carboxyl group of glutamic acid (Glu) are protected by OtBu (tert-butyl) groups, which shield these functional groups until selective deprotection is needed. Aib (α-aminoisobutyric acid), known for its ability to induce helical structures, is the third residue, and Gly (Glycine), the final amino acid, has a free carboxyl group at the C-terminus, indicated by -OH, allowing for further coupling or modifications. This peptide incorporates D-tyrosine, Aib, glutamic acid, and glycine into peptide sequences, with specific protections to ensure controlled and efficient synthesis.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-OH
Boc-D-Tyr(OtBu)-Aib-OH is a protected dipeptide used in peptide synthesis. The Boc (tert-Butoxycarbonyl) group protects the N-terminus of the D-tyrosine (D-Tyr) residue, preventing unwanted reactions during synthesis. The hydroxyl group on the D-tyrosine side chain is protected by an OtBu (tert-butyl) group, safeguarding it from reactivity until selective deprotection is desired. Aib (α-aminoisobutyric acid) is the second amino acid in the sequence, a non-natural amino acid known for inducing helical structures in peptides. The -OH at the C-terminus indicates a free carboxyl group, allowing for further peptide coupling. This compound is utilized to introduce D-tyrosine and Aib into peptides, with specific protections ensuring controlled and selective synthesis while incorporating structural constraints. Boceprevir
Boceprevir (EBP 520) is a potent, highly selective, orally bioavailable HCV NS3 protease inhibitor with a K i of 14 nM in both enzyme assay and an EC 90 of 350 nM in cell-based replicon assay [1] [2] [3] [4] [5]. Boceprevir inhibits SARS-CoV-2 3CL pro activity [6]. Uses: Scientific research. Group: Signaling pathways. Alternative Names: EBP 520; SCH 503034. CAS No. 394730-60-0. Boc-Gln-Arg-Arg-AMC acetate
Boc-Gln-Arg-Arg-AMC acetate is a fluorogenic substrate for the determination of protease activity. Boc-Gln-Arg-Arg-AMC undergoes hydrolysis and releases the fluorescent product 7-amino-4-methylcoumarin (AMC). AMC is fluorescent under UV light and can emit a fluorescent signal[1].
